The relevance of reinforcement learning extends across diverse sectors, including finance, healthcare, robotics, and gaming. For instance, in finance, RL is used to optimize trading strategies by dynamically adapting to market conditions. Similarly, in healthcare, RL models assist in personalized treatment plans by analyzing patient responses to interventions over time. Consider the case of AlphaGo, developed by DeepMind, which defeated world champions in the game of Go using RL techniques. This achievement not only showcased the power of RL but also inspired advancements in fields such as drug discovery and logistics optimization.
